Lamb Weston Charitable Foundation is located in Eagle, ID. The organization was established in 2019. According to its NTEE Classification (T50) the organization is classified as: Philanthropy, Charity & Voluntarism Promotion, under the broad grouping of Philanthropy, Voluntarism & Grantmaking Foundations and related organizations. This organization is an independent organization and not affiliated with a larger national or regional group of organizations. Lamb Weston Charitable Foundation is a 501(c)(3) and as such, is described as a "Charitable or Religous organization or a private foundation" by the IRS.
For the year ending 12/2022, Lamb Weston Charitable Foundation generated $4.5m in total revenue. The organization has seen a slow decline revenue. Over the past 4 years, revenues have fallen by an average of (2.6%) each year. All expenses for the organization totaled $944.4k during the year ending 12/2022. Describe the Organization's Program Activity:
Part 3 - Line 4a
COMMUNITY PROGRAMS: GRANT-MAKING TO 501(C)(3) TAX-EXEMPT CHARITIES THAT SUPPORT THE COMMUNITIES WHERE LAMB WESTON OPERATES, AND ITS EMPLOYEES LIVE AND WORK.
EMPLOYEE MATCHING: FUND A MATCHING GIFTS PROGRAM FOR EMPLOYEES OF LAMB WESTON.
EMPLOYEE SCHOLARSHIP PROGRAM: GRANT-MAKING TO STUDENTS OF EMPLOYEES WHO ARE ATTENDING A QUALIFYING UNIVERSITY OR COLLEGE.
